See list of politicians that were in PDP and now in apc

1. Senate President Bukola Saraki

PDP governor for 8 years and senator for over 3 years. He joined the APC in 2014.

2. Speaker of the House of Representatives; Honourable Yakubu Dogara

Two-term PDP House of Representatives member. He joined the APC in 2014.

3. Former Vice President; Alhaji Atiku Abubakar

PDP VP for 8 years and presently an APC elder statesman after jumping from one party to the other since 2007.

4. Senator Victor Ndoma-Egba

PDP senator for 12 years. He defected to the APC last year. He is the serving chairman of the Niger Delta Development Commission board.

5. Senator Heineken Lokpobiri

Two-term PDP senator from Bayelsa state. He defected to APC after the 2015 elections. He is currently the minister of state for agriculture.

6. Senator Barnabas Gemade

Former national chairman of the PDP and senator from 2011 till date. He joined APC in December 2014.

7. Chief Audu Ogbeh

Former PDP chairman. Currently the minister of agriculture

8. Senator Ita Enang

Two-term PDP senator from Akwa-Ibom. He joined APC before the 2015 elections. He is presently the senior special assistant to the president on the National Assembly (Senate).

9. Governor Samuel Ortom of Benue state

Former Benue state secretary of the PDP. Former national auditor of the PDP and former minister under President Goodluck Jonathan. He joined the APC in December 2014.

10. Governor Atiku Bagudu of Kebbi state

A former two-term PDP senator from Kebbi.

11. Governor Aminu Tambuwal of Sokoto state

Former PDP Speaker of the House of Representatives. He joined the APC in 2014.

12. Senator Abdullahi Adamu

Two-term PDP governor of Nasarawa and senator in 2011. He joined the APC in 2014.

13. Senator Danjuma Goje

Two-term PDP governor of Gombe state and senator in 2011. He joined the APC in 2014.

14. Honourable Dakuku Peterside

He was a PDP House of Reps member from Rivers state. He joined the in 2014. He is currently the Director-General of NIMASA.

15. Senator Rabiu Kwankwaso

Two-term PDP governor of Kano state and former minister of defence under President Olusegun Obasanjo. He joined the APC in late 2013.

16. Mr Rotimi Amaechi

Former PDP Speaker of the Rivers state House of Assembly. Two-term PDP governor of Rivers. He joined APC in late 2013. He is currently the minister of transport.

17. Governor Rochas Okorocha of Imo state

He was a special adviser to PDP's President Olusegun Obasanjo. He joined APC in February 2013.

18. Senator George Akume

Two-term PDP governor of Benue state and senator in 2007. Left the party in December 2010 for the APC.

19. Governor Nasir El-Rufai of Kaduna state

Former FCT minister under President Obasanjo. Left the PDP in 2010.

20. Governor Bello Masari of Katsina state

PDP Speaker of the House of Reps from 2003 to 2007.

21. Senator Adamu Aliero

Two-term PDP governor of Kebbi state and senator in 2007. Later became FCT minister under Late President Umaru Musa Yar'Adua.

22. Senator Udoma Udo Udoma

Two-term PDP senator from Akwa-Ibom state. He is now the minister of budget and national planning.

23. Senator Chris Ngige

Anambra state governor under the PDP between 2003 to 2006. He is currently the minister of labour and employment.

24. Senator Andy Uba

Recently defected from the PDP to the APC after serving as a special assistant to former President Obasanjo and PDP senator for 5 years.

25. Governor Simon Lalong of Plateau state

Former Seaker of the Plateau state House of Assembly under the PDP.

26. Senator Joshua Dariye

Former governor of Plateau state for 8 years under the PDP.

27. Engineer Segun Oni

PDP governor for 3 years in Ekiti state. He is currently the APC national vice chairman for South west

28. Governor Abiola Ajimobi of Oyo state

PDP senator between 2004 to 2007 representing Oyo central senatorial district.

29. Governor Ibikunle Amosun from Ogun state

PDP senator from 2003 to 2007 representing Ogun central senatorial district
